spotted coral root

spotted coral root

Overview of noun spotted_coral_root

The noun spotted coral root has 1 sense

  • spotted coral root, Corallorhiza maculata -- (common coral root having yellowish- or reddish- or purplish-brown leafless stems bearing loose racemes of similarly colored flowers with white purple-spotted lips; Guatemala to Canada)